THE Rafflesian family clinched four out of six titles on offer at the 56th National Schools Cross Country Championships Wednesday morning at Bedok Reservoir Park.
They emerged victorious in the A and C Division Boys categories, in addition to sweeping both the girls' titles in the B and C Divisions.
However, they fell short in the A Girls and B Boys categories, finishing second and fifth respectively.
Victoria Junior College also put in a commanding performance, clinching the A Division Girls' title while the A Division Boys finished runners-up.
Results
A Division
Boys: 1) Raffles Institution (RI) 2) VJC 3) Anglo-Chinese School Independent (ACS(I))
Girls: 1) VJC 2) RI 3) Hwa Chong Institution (HCI)
B Division
Boys: 1) ACS(I) 2) St Joseph's Institution (SJI) 3) Victoria School (VS)
Girls: 1) Raffles Girls' School (RGS) 2) Cedar Girls' Secondary School (CGSS) 3) Guang Yang Secondary School (GYSS)
C Division
Boys: 1) RI 2) HCI 3) SJI
Girls: 1) RGS 2) Nan Hua High School 3) CGSS
